Property Description

Charming Location
Nestled in Ashby Saint Ledgers and just 30 km from Kelmarsh Hall, The Olde Coach House Inn provides a picturesque setting with easy access to nearby attractions.

Comfortable Accommodation
Guests can enjoy cozy rooms, a garden, and free private parking at this 3-star hotel. The property also features a restaurant, bar, and complimentary WiFi for a relaxing stay.

Delicious Dining
Start your day right with a choice of Continental or Full English/Irish breakfast options served each morning at the hotel.
